To put your foot in your mouth (or put one’s foot in one’s mouth) means to say something embarrassing, tactless, unintentionally insulting, or socially awkward; to commit a social blunder by saying something foolish. Definition: To say something embarrassing or inconsiderate, especially at an inappropriate moment.
